1

Digital Payment Systems

News Discuss 
Navigating the evolving digital marketplace landscape demands robust and secure online financial solutions. Vendors are increasingly seeking methods to streamline the checkout process, reduce fraud, and enhance the https://elodieytyq103472.sunderwiki.com/user

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story